本発明は、稲の種子を苗箱に播種して水田に移植するまでに育苗した可撓性のポット苗箱を育苗場所から搬送する可撓性ポット苗箱の運搬装置に関するものである。 The present invention relates to a transport device for a flexible pot seedling box for transporting a flexible pot seedling box grown from seeding of rice seeds in a seedling box and transplanting it to a paddy field from a nursery place .

可撓性のポット苗箱として意匠登録第0507139号公報(特許文献1)や特開平10−136794号公報(特許文献2)が既に知られ実用化されている。これらのポット苗箱は湾曲自在の可撓性に優れた素材が用いられ、特に長手方向を湾曲させるのに優れているものである。従来からいくつかこの可撓性のポット苗を育苗場所から植えつける圃場まで運搬するための運搬具や運搬棚が発明されている。   Design registration No. 0507139 (Patent Document 1) and Japanese Patent Application Laid-Open No. 10-136794 (Patent Document 2) are already known and put into practical use as flexible pot seedling boxes. These pot seedling boxes are made of a flexible material that can be freely bent, and are particularly excellent in bending the longitudinal direction. Conventionally, a transporting tool and a transport shelf have been invented for transporting some of these flexible pot seedlings from a seedling raising place to a field to be planted.

特開2004−194630号公報(特許文献3)などは、運搬車輌に運搬棚を搭載し、一度に多くのポット苗箱を搭載して運搬しようとするものであり、また特開2002−315410号公報(特許文献4)では、棒材を組み合わせてカゴ状に形成し、ポット苗箱を平面状に並列に複数配置できる苗箱運搬カゴであって、しかもこの運搬カゴが積み重ねられるものも既に公知である。   Japanese Patent Laid-Open No. 2004-194630 (Patent Document 3) and the like are intended to carry a carrying shelf on a carrying vehicle and to carry a lot of pot seedling boxes at a time, and Japanese Patent Laid-Open No. 2002-315410. In the gazette (Patent Document 4), a seedling box transporting basket in which a plurality of pot seedling boxes can be arranged in parallel in a planar shape by combining rods, and the transporting baskets are stacked is already known. It is.

そして、特開平9−168320号公報(特許文献5)では、並列に配した二本のフレームの側面にアームを植設して、そのアームを上方に向けて掛止してそのアーム間又はアームと支柱の間にポット苗箱を湾曲させて挿入して運搬する運搬具も公知となっている。   In Japanese Patent Application Laid-Open No. 9-168320 (Patent Document 5), an arm is planted on the side surface of two frames arranged in parallel, and the arm is hooked upward, and between the arms or the arms. Also known is a carrying device for inserting and carrying a pot seedling box in a curved manner between the support post.

意匠登録第0507139号公報Design Registration No. 0507139 特開平10−136794号公報JP-A-10-136794 特開2004−194630号公報JP 2004-194630 A 特開2002−315410号公報JP 2002-315410 A 特開平9−168320号公報JP 9-168320 A

特許文献3におけるポット苗運搬棚においては、運搬車輌に前もって外枠、内枠等からなる運搬棚を構成するフレームと、そのフレームの内部に稲苗棚を角度をもって備えて、その稲苗棚にポット苗箱をそれぞれ搭載して運搬する構成となっている。稲苗棚の数だけポット苗箱の運搬を可能とするため数多くの苗箱の運搬を可能とするが、運搬車輌に稲苗棚を搭載するためのフレームを設置する必要があることと、稲苗棚には平面状にポット苗箱を搭載するため、運搬車輌の走行中にポット苗に走行風が当り、苗自体を傷めてしまう欠点がある。   In the pot seedling transport shelf in Patent Document 3, a frame constituting a transport shelf composed of an outer frame, an inner frame and the like is provided in advance on the transport vehicle, and a rice seedling shelf is provided at an angle inside the frame. Each pot seedling box is loaded and transported. Many seedling boxes can be transported in order to transport as many pot seedling boxes as there are rice seedling shelves. However, it is necessary to install a frame to mount rice seedling racks on the transport vehicle, and Since a pot seedling box is mounted on the seedling shelf in a flat shape, there is a drawback that traveling wind hits the pot seedling while the transport vehicle is traveling, and the seedling itself is damaged.

特許文献4の苗箱運搬カゴにおいては、育苗地から運搬車輌までの運搬を複数枚を一度に運搬を可能とし、運搬車両にも運搬カゴに搭載した状態でしかも段み搭載を可能とするが、安定性にかける欠点を有すると共に、運搬カゴに平面状に苗箱が差し込まれているので、運搬車輌の走行時の走行風を苗自体が受け苗の品質の低下を招いてしまう事となる。 In seedling box carrying basket of Patent Document 4, the transport from nursery location to transport vehicles to allow carrying a plurality at a time, also enables the state, yet mounted viewing stage product mounted on the transport car for transportation vehicles but which has the drawback of subjecting the stability, the seedling box in a plane in the transport cage is inserted, it thereby causing a reduction in the quality of seedlings traveling wind during travel of the carrier vehicle by receiving the seedlings themselves It becomes.

また、特許文献5に記載のポット苗箱の運搬具においては、植生されているポット苗箱を内側に湾曲させてアーム間又はアームと支柱の間に挟みこんだ状態でセットできるように構成されているので、植生されたポット苗箱を内側に湾曲させることによって運搬車輌に搭載し走行した場合の走行風の影響を受けにくくなる利点はあるが、苗箱の底面が下方向を向いて差し込まれているだけであるので、垂直方向から加わる力には弱く、苗箱が変形しないようそれぞれの苗箱同士が触れ合わない間隔を取る必要があって運搬具自体の構造が苗箱より大きくる必要性がある。このことは植生されたポット苗箱をセットした運搬具を一人で育苗地から運搬車輌までの間を運搬し、運搬車輌に搭載することは困難であって、またポット苗箱を移植地に下ろした後の空の運搬具を持ち帰る場合の荷台の専有率には変化は無く、または使用しないときの保管場所の面積を多く必要とするものであり、この運搬具に苗箱を搭載しないとき又は保管時の取扱姓が良好とは言い難いものである。 In addition, the pot seedling box carrier described in Patent Document 5 is configured so that the planted pot seedling box can be set while being bent inward and sandwiched between the arms or between the arm and the column. Therefore, there is an advantage that the planted pot seedling box is bent inward so that it is less affected by the driving wind when running on a transport vehicle, but the bottom of the seedling box is inserted downward since that is only being weak in the force applied from the vertical direction, the structure of the vehicles themselves I need to take apart that each seedling box between not touch each to seedling box is not deformed be greater than seedling box There is a need to This means that it is difficult to transport a carrier with a planted pot seedling box from the nursery to the transporting vehicle alone and to mount it on the transporting vehicle. There is no change in the occupancy rate of the loading platform when taking an empty transporter after it has been taken home, or it requires a large storage area when not in use, and when a seedling box is not mounted on this transporter or It is hard to say that the surname at the time of storage is good.

そこで、本発明においては、ポット苗の育苗地から1つの運搬具に複数のポット苗箱を内面に湾曲させて積載可能としてその状態で運搬車輌に搭載が出来ると共に、ポット苗箱の湾曲させた面を底面として、ポット苗箱自体が上方からの垂直方向に加わる力に対して強度をもって構成されているため、運搬車輌に複数段の運搬具の段積を可能として、育苗地から田植圃場までの一度の運搬で数多くのポット苗箱を搬送することが出来ると共に、育成した苗を内側に湾曲させ苗同士を密着させることで運搬車輌の走行時の走行風を苗自体が受けることを防止できる可撓性ポット苗箱の運搬装置を提供するものである。 Therefore, in the present invention, a plurality of pot seedling boxes can be curved on the inner surface from one pot seedling nursery to be carried and loaded on the transport vehicle in that state, and the pot seedling box is curved. Since the pot seedling box itself is structured with strength against the force applied in the vertical direction from above with the surface as the bottom surface, it is possible to stack multiple stages of transporting equipment on the transport vehicle, from seedlings to rice planting fields A large number of pot seedling boxes can be transported with a single transport, and the seedlings themselves are prevented from receiving the wind during traveling of the transport vehicle by curving the grown seedlings inward and bringing the seedlings into close contact with each other. A flexible pot seedling box transport device is provided.

本発明に係る可撓性ポット苗箱の積載方法及びその運搬具は、育苗地2にてポット苗3が5葉から6葉と成苗と呼ばれるまで成長し、水田に移植可能な状態のポット苗3を植生したポット苗箱1の積載方法及びその運搬具に関するものである。   The method for loading a flexible pot seedling box and its carrying device according to the present invention is a pot in a state where the pot seedling 3 grows from 5 leaves to 6 leaves and is called an adult seedling in the nursery 2 and can be transplanted to paddy fields. The present invention relates to a method for loading the pot seedling box 1 in which the seedling 3 is vegetated and its transporting device.

図1のように、ポット苗箱1は複数の苗室4を有してその苗室4内にはポット苗3が生育しているものである。このポット苗箱1は縁部5の辺方向の可撓性に優れ、縁部5をU形状に湾曲させることは容易であって、ポット苗箱1のポット苗3が生育している育成面6を内側になるようにU形状に湾曲させ、ポット苗3同士を密着させるものである(図2)。   As shown in FIG. 1, the pot seedling box 1 has a plurality of seedling rooms 4 in which pot seedlings 3 are grown. The pot seedling box 1 has excellent flexibility in the side direction of the edge part 5, it is easy to curve the edge part 5 into a U shape, and the growing surface on which the pot seedling 3 of the pot seedling box 1 is growing 6 is curved in a U shape so as to be inside, and the pot seedlings 3 are brought into close contact with each other (FIG. 2).

そして図3に示すように、U形状の湾曲面となったポット苗箱1の縁部5の一方の側面を下向きにして、搬送手段の平面若しくは運搬具の平面に密着させるように積載するものである。尚、ポット苗箱1の縁部7の両方の側面が搬送手段若しくは運搬具の平面に対して角度90度となる垂直面に接しているとより安定して積載が可能になるほか、U形状に湾曲させたポット苗箱1を並列に複数並べるときの基準面となる。   Then, as shown in FIG. 3, the stacking is performed so that one side surface of the edge portion 5 of the pot seedling box 1 having a U-shaped curved surface faces downward and is brought into close contact with the plane of the transport means or the plane of the transport tool. It is. In addition, when both sides of the edge portion 7 of the pot seedling box 1 are in contact with a vertical surface having an angle of 90 degrees with respect to the plane of the transport means or transporter, the stable loading is possible. It becomes a reference surface when arranging a plurality of pot seedling boxes 1 curved in parallel.

U形状に湾曲させたポット苗箱1は、U形状から平板状に戻ろうとする反発力が加わるので、運搬手段及び運搬具に積載した場合にはU形状の直線部分の苗室4の裏面を両サイドから押さえるとポット苗箱1が開かなくて良い。   The pot seedling box 1 curved into a U shape is subjected to a repulsive force to return from the U shape to a flat plate shape. The pot seedling box 1 does not have to be opened by pressing from both sides.

ポット苗箱1はポット苗3が生育する生育面6が内側に向く方向で縁部5をU形状の湾曲面として、ポット苗3のそれぞれが密着するように重なり合わせることによって、育苗地2から植付圃場までの輸送手段となる車輌等の荷台に搭載した場合の走行風をポット苗3が直接受けることがなくなるので、稲の葉同士が常に擦れ合うことで発生する稲の弱体化を防止できるものである。また、縁部5のU形状の湾曲面となった一方の側面を底面として、搬送手段又は運搬具の平面に自立させているため、ポット苗箱1自体が垂直方向から加わる荷重を受けても変形せず、ポット苗箱1を段積しても、下方のポット苗箱1自体が上方のポット苗3を備えるポット苗箱1の重量を支えることができると共に、苗箱のU形状となった段差の無い広い平面で、上方のポット苗箱1を受けることが出来るため、安定して複数の段積を行うことが可能となる利点も有している。 The pot seedling box 1 is formed from the nursery 2 by overlapping the pot seedlings 3 so that each of the pot seedlings 3 is in close contact with the edge 5 as a U-shaped curved surface in the direction in which the growth surface 6 on which the pot seedlings 3 grow is directed inward. Since the pot seedling 3 does not directly receive the traveling wind when mounted on the loading platform of a vehicle or the like as a means of transportation to the planting field, it is possible to prevent the weakening of the rice that occurs when the rice leaves constantly rub against each other. Is. Further, since one side surface of the edge portion 5 that is a U-shaped curved surface is used as a bottom surface and is self-supporting on the plane of the transport means or transporter, even if the pot seedling box 1 itself receives a load applied from the vertical direction. Even if the pot seedling boxes 1 are stacked without deformation, the lower pot seedling box 1 itself can support the weight of the pot seedling box 1 with the upper pot seedling 3 and has a U shape of the seedling box. Since the upper pot seedling box 1 can be received on a wide flat surface without any level difference, there is also an advantage that a plurality of stages can be stably performed.

図4の8は可撓性のポット苗箱の運搬具である。この運搬具8は水平方向の自立面9と自立面9と約90度の角度をもった垂直板10からなるL字構成であることを特徴としている。垂直板10には、自立面9方向に向かって複数の背面板11が略等間隔で縦方向に備えている。この背面板11は上端が垂直板10と同等の高さで、下端は自立面9と接触する長さでしかも自立面9と接合されているとよい。また、背面板11の先端には垂直板10と平行面となるように規制板12が取り付けられている。この規制板12も縦方向に向かって細長に取り付けられており、その上端は垂直板10と同等の高さで、下端は自立面9と接しない距離をもって備えられている。   Reference numeral 8 in FIG. 4 is a carrying device for a flexible pot seedling box. The carrier 8 is characterized by an L-shaped configuration comprising a horizontal self-standing surface 9 and a vertical plate 10 having an angle of about 90 degrees with the self-standing surface 9. The vertical plate 10 is provided with a plurality of back plates 11 in the vertical direction at substantially equal intervals toward the self-standing surface 9. The back plate 11 may have an upper end that is the same height as the vertical plate 10 and a lower end that is in contact with the self-supporting surface 9 and that is joined to the self-supporting surface 9. A regulating plate 12 is attached to the front end of the back plate 11 so as to be parallel to the vertical plate 10. The restricting plate 12 is also attached to be elongated in the vertical direction, and the upper end thereof is the same height as the vertical plate 10, and the lower end is provided with a distance that does not contact the self-standing surface 9.

さらに、垂直板10の上端には自立面9と対向する方向に取手部13が垂直板10の略全長に渡り設けられている。この取手部13は角パイプやC形鋼と呼ばれる鋼材であるとよく、この取手部13の両端には上方から棒状の固定材が差し込める大きさの貫通穴14が取手部13を貫いて設けられている。   Further, a handle portion 13 is provided at the upper end of the vertical plate 10 in the direction facing the self-standing surface 9 over substantially the entire length of the vertical plate 10. This handle portion 13 is preferably a square pipe or a steel material called C-shaped steel, and through holes 14 are provided at both ends of the handle portion 13 so that a rod-shaped fixing material can be inserted from above through the handle portion 13. It has been.

垂直板10には、背面板11同士間の中央を基準として横方向に背面板11に至らない範囲に、そして縦方向では取手部13の略下面から自立面9に至らない範囲で開口している開口面15を備える。この開口面15には、運搬具8を使用する運搬者がこの開口部15に手又は指を通し、取手部13を握り締めて安定して運搬具8を保持する目的と、運搬具8自体の重量を軽量化する目的で備えられているものである。   The vertical plate 10 is opened in a range that does not reach the back plate 11 in the lateral direction with respect to the center between the back plates 11 and in a range that does not reach the free-standing surface 9 from the substantially lower surface of the handle portion 13 in the vertical direction. The opening surface 15 is provided. On the opening surface 15, a carrier who uses the carrier 8 puts a hand or a finger through the opening 15, grasps the handle portion 13 and holds the carrier 8 stably, and the carrier 8 itself. It is provided for the purpose of reducing the weight.

さらに、自立面9の平面方向の端部の範囲は、図6のようにポット苗箱1を湾曲させて運搬具に積載させた場合にU形状の湾曲面の縁部5を覆う範囲であるとよい。また、ポット苗箱1の湾曲面の略中心に位置するように開口面16を設けてもよく、この開口面16によって運搬具8の重量をより軽くすることが可能である。   Furthermore, the range of the edge part of the planar direction of the self-supporting surface 9 is a range which covers the edge part 5 of the U-shaped curved surface when the pot seedling box 1 is curved and loaded on the transporter as shown in FIG. Good. Moreover, you may provide the opening surface 16 so that it may be located in the approximate center of the curved surface of the pot seedling box 1, and the weight of the conveyance tool 8 can be made lighter by this opening surface 16. FIG.

図6のように、ポット苗箱1の育苗面6が内側を向くように縁部5をU形状に湾曲させ、その湾曲面の一方の側面を下側に向け、ポット苗箱1の両側の縁部7の端側から2列目の苗室4の底面が背面板11に接触するように、また両側の縁部7の端側から2列目と3列目の苗室4に挟まれた空間に規制板12が差し込まれるように、運搬具8の上方からポット苗箱1を垂直に差し込むか、縁部5のU形状の湾曲を一時的に多く曲げて自立面9の端部から水平に入れ込んで作業者が手を放すことでU形状と成って、背面板11には苗室4の底面が密着し、そして規制板12が苗室4に挟まれた空間に入り込んでポット苗箱1の前後左右の移動を固定するものである。   As shown in FIG. 6, the edge 5 is curved in a U shape so that the seedling surface 6 of the pot seedling box 1 faces inward, and one side of the curved surface faces downward, It is sandwiched between the seedling chambers 4 in the second row and the third row from the end sides of the edge 7 on both sides so that the bottom surface of the seedling chamber 4 in the second row from the end side of the edge portion 7 is in contact with the back plate 11. The pot seedling box 1 is inserted vertically from above the transport device 8 so that the regulating plate 12 is inserted into the open space, or the U-shaped curve of the edge 5 is temporarily bent many times from the end of the self-standing surface 9. When the operator puts it horizontally and releases the hand, it becomes U-shaped, the bottom surface of the seedling chamber 4 is in close contact with the back plate 11, and the regulation plate 12 enters the space sandwiched between the seedling chamber 4 and the pot The movement of the seedling box 1 from front to back and from side to side is fixed.

本発明の実施例として図4、6のように、湾曲させた5枚のポット苗箱1を並列に5列積載できるようになっている。通常ポット苗箱を運搬する車輌として軽トラック、小型トラックが多く使用されているため、それらのトラックの荷台幅と、苗箱の寸法を検討すると5列の運搬具が良好である。また、背面板11と規制板12の取り付けにおいて、運搬具8の両端の規制板12は背面板11との形状がL形状であるが、その他の背面板11と規制板12との取り付け形状はT形状となっている。運搬具8の両端の背面板11と規制板12の取り付け形状はT形状であってもよいが、運搬具8のその全長を短く、しかも安全性を考慮してL形状としたものである。   As an embodiment of the present invention, as shown in FIGS. 4 and 6, five curved pot seedling boxes 1 can be stacked in parallel in five rows. Usually, light trucks and small trucks are often used as vehicles for transporting pot seedling boxes. Therefore, when considering the loading platform width of these trucks and the size of the seedling boxes, five rows of carrying devices are good. In addition, in the attachment of the back plate 11 and the restriction plate 12, the restriction plate 12 at both ends of the carrier 8 is L-shaped with the back plate 11, but the other attachment shapes of the back plate 11 and the restriction plate 12 are as follows. It has a T shape. The mounting shape of the back plate 11 and the regulating plate 12 at both ends of the transporting device 8 may be T-shaped, but the entire length of the transporting device 8 is short and is L-shaped in consideration of safety.

図7は、運搬具8にポット苗箱1を5列全て積載した状態を表す図であって、作業者21は図8のように開口面15に指又は手を通し、取手部13を握り運搬具8を持ち上げ移動させるものである。   FIG. 7 is a diagram showing a state in which all five rows of pot seedling boxes 1 are loaded on the transporting device 8, and the operator 21 puts the handle 13 through his / her finger or hand through the opening surface 15 as shown in FIG. 8. The carrier 8 is lifted and moved.

図9は、育苗地2から運搬車輌(トラック等)まで、若しくは育苗地2から近い水田までポット苗箱を運搬する様子を示したものである。育苗地2で作業者21がポット苗箱1を運搬具8に積載し、それを手押し式運搬車17に複数個搭載して運搬具8を移動している。手押し式運搬車17として、通常は車輪18が一輪若しくは二輪の手押し式運搬車17が代表されるが、これらの手押し式運搬車17にはポット苗箱1を積載した状態で運搬具8を3個から4個搭載することが出来るため、手押し式運搬車であっても一度に15枚から20枚ほどのポット苗箱1を運搬することが可能である。   FIG. 9 shows a state in which the pot seedling box is transported from the nursery 2 to a transport vehicle (truck or the like) or from the nursery 2 to a nearby paddy field. An operator 21 loads the pot seedling box 1 on the transporter 8 in the nursery 2 and loads a plurality of the seedling boxes 1 on the hand-carried transport vehicle 17 to move the transporter 8. As the hand-carried transport vehicle 17, a wheeled transport vehicle 17 having one or two wheels 18 is typically represented, but these hand-carried transport vehicles 17 are loaded with a transporting device 8 in a state where the pot seedling box 1 is loaded. Since four to four can be mounted, it is possible to carry 15 to 20 pot seedling boxes 1 at a time even with a hand-held transporter.

図10は、ポット苗箱1を積載した運搬具8を上下方向に段積にした状態を示している。運搬具8の垂直板10と取手部13のその高さは、ポット苗箱1を湾曲させて運搬具8に積載させた場合の縁部7と同じ高さ又はそれより低くなるように構成されている。   FIG. 10 shows a state in which the carrier 8 loaded with the pot seedling box 1 is stacked in the vertical direction. The height of the vertical plate 10 and the handle portion 13 of the transporting device 8 is configured to be the same as or lower than the edge 7 when the pot seedling box 1 is curved and loaded on the transporting device 8. ing.

運搬具8を複数段積み重ねた状態で棒状の固定材19を、取手部13に設けられているそれぞれの貫通穴14に通すことによって積み重ねられた上方の運搬具8の前後左右の移動を固定し、安定して数段積み重ねることができる。さらに縁部7の辺長より垂直板10の高さが短く構成されているので、運搬具8の自立面9の底がポット苗箱1の縁部5の湾曲面と密着して、上段のポット苗箱と運搬具の垂直に加わる重量を苗箱自体で受け止めると共に、U形状面の広い面積で上方の自立面9の底を受け止めるため安定感が増しているものである。   With the transporting device 8 stacked in a plurality of stages, a rod-shaped fixing member 19 is passed through each through hole 14 provided in the handle portion 13 to fix the movement of the upper transporting device 8 stacked in the front-rear and left-right directions. It can be stacked several times stably. Furthermore, since the height of the vertical plate 10 is configured to be shorter than the side length of the edge portion 7, the bottom of the self-standing surface 9 of the carrier 8 is in close contact with the curved surface of the edge portion 5 of the pot seedling box 1, and In addition to receiving the vertical weight of the pot seedling box and the carrier with the seedling box itself, the stability is increased because the bottom of the upper free-standing surface 9 is received over a large area of the U-shaped surface.

図11は、運搬車輌20に運搬具8を複数列、複数段搭載した状態を例示したものである。そして運搬具8を3段に積み重ねて棒状の固定材19を上方からそれぞれの運搬具8の貫通穴14に差込み、積み重ねた上方の運搬具8の前後左右の移動を固定している。   FIG. 11 illustrates a state in which a plurality of transporting devices 8 are mounted on the transporting vehicle 20 in a plurality of rows and stages. Then, the transporting devices 8 are stacked in three stages, and rod-shaped fixing members 19 are inserted into the through holes 14 of the transporting devices 8 from above, and the movement of the stacked transporting devices 8 in the front, rear, left, and right directions is fixed.

運搬車輌20として軽トラックの荷台にこの運搬具8を積み重ねた場合、運搬具8を6列に並べ、そして3段積にすることによって、ポット苗箱1を一度に運搬車輌20に搭載できる個数は90枚となり、ポット苗箱を効率よく運搬することが可能である。   When the transporter 8 is stacked on a light truck bed as the transporting vehicle 20, the number of pot seedling boxes 1 that can be mounted on the transporting vehicle 20 at a time by arranging the transporting devices 8 in six rows and forming a three-stage stack. Is 90 sheets, and the pot seedling box can be efficiently transported.

図12は、育苗地2から運搬車輌20までポット苗箱1を運搬する形態を示したものであって、作業者21は育苗地2内若しくはその付近に空の運搬具8を置き、育苗地2から取り上げたポット苗箱1を運搬具8に積載する。育苗地2が広く運搬具8を直接運搬車輌20に搭載するのに距離がある場合などは、手押し式運搬車17(一輪車)に一時的にポット苗箱1を積載した運搬具8を複数搭載して運搬車輌20まで搬送することで、作業者21は手間をかけずに運搬具8を効率的に運搬車輌20に搭載することが出来る。   FIG. 12 shows a mode in which the pot seedling box 1 is transported from the seedling nursery 2 to the transporting vehicle 20, and the worker 21 places an empty transporter 8 in or near the nursery seedling 2, The pot seedling box 1 picked up from 2 is loaded on the carrier 8. When the nursery 2 is wide and there is a distance to mount the transporting device 8 directly on the transporting vehicle 20, a plurality of transporting devices 8 in which the pot seedling box 1 is temporarily loaded on the hand-held transporting vehicle 17 (unicycle) are mounted. By transporting to the transport vehicle 20, the operator 21 can efficiently mount the transport tool 8 on the transport vehicle 20 without taking time and effort.

図13に示す運搬具8は、田植を行う圃場で運搬具8からポット苗箱1を下ろして運搬具8だけを運搬車輌20に搭載した場合と、運搬具8を使用しない場合の収納状態を表したものである。運搬具8の自立面9の表面に重ね合わせる運搬具8の自立面9の裏面が、そして規制板12には重ね合わせる運搬具8の取手部13が密着するように重ね合わせることによって、運搬具8を数多く保管収納しなくてはならない場合であっても、取手部13と背面板11と規制板12の厚みで重ね合わせることが可能であるので、収納する面積も少なくなり、取扱性にも優れるものである。   The carrying device 8 shown in FIG. 13 shows the storage state when the pot seedling box 1 is lowered from the carrying device 8 and only the carrying device 8 is mounted on the carrying vehicle 20 in the field where rice planting is performed, and when the carrying device 8 is not used. It is a representation. By superimposing the back surface of the self-supporting surface 9 of the transporting device 8 to be superimposed on the surface of the self-supporting surface 9 of the transporting device 8 and the control plate 12 so that the handle portion 13 of the transporting device 8 to be superimposed is in close contact, the transporting device Even when a large number of 8 need to be stored and stored, it is possible to overlap with the thickness of the handle portion 13, the back plate 11, and the regulating plate 12. It is excellent.
